Most travelers start their Serengeti National Park Safari from Morogoro by road transfer to Arusha followed by a scenic overland safari drive or a short domestic flight to Serengeti airstrips. The journey is carefully planned to maximize comfort, wildlife viewing time, and travel efficiency.
Travelers can choose from budget camping safaris, mid-range tented camps, and luxury safari lodges. Each option provides unique comfort levels while maintaining prime wildlife access within Serengeti National Park.
In addition to the Big Five, Serengeti is home to cheetahs, giraffes, zebras, wildebeests, hippos, crocodiles, hyenas, and over 500 bird species, making it one of Tanzania’s most wildlife-rich safari destinations.
